The Nicaraguan project, ‘Lighting Up Hope and Communities’, received a SEED Award in 2008 for its production and sale of solar products (such as food cookers and driers) specially designed for local needs.
The Solar Women are now working on the construction of a restaurant, well-situated on the Pan-American highway, where they can serve their own solar food. They continue to promote the benefits of renewable energy whilst empowering rural women.
